"No Indian film has been made on such high standards as Kites" - Rakesh Roshan

Rakesh Roshan If success starts from the alphabet 'S', Rakesh Roshan would deny it hands down. For him though, 'K' has always been the word which would define success ever since his Khudgarz days. Thanks to a fan who wrote a letter to Rakesh while he was an actor and suggested him to make films as a producer and a director starting with 'K'. There was no looking back for Roshan after he read the letter. Then followed hits and only hits, blockbusters and only blockbusters and Hrithik Roshan and only Hrithik Roshan. With his new film Kites being the talk of the town, Rakesh relishes some good memories about the alphabet 'K', talks about his star son, his conviction in Anurag Basu, the new find Barbara Mori, the talented Kangna Ranaut and why Bollywood is still a small pond where our industry is happy being in. All this with UK's Harrow Observer columnist and Bollywood Hungama's London correspondent - Devansh Patel. Oh! I forgot something...and his big quote - "I can vouch for Kites that not a single film in India is made up to the standard of this film." (V)ouch! Hrithik Roshan - The star son Hrithik's goal is not to cross over and do Hollywood films. No. That is not his goal. Our goal is to show to the world market that India can make good films too because we too have good actors and good technicians. If we succeed in Kites, and if there is an offer for Hrithik from the West, he isn't going to leave India and settle down there. He might do one film to work with some better filmmakers out there. It will be a big pride for me and my family if Hrithik does a Hollywood film and with Kites, I am pushing him into the world market. If we succeed in Kites, and if there is an offer for Hrithik from the West, he isn't going to leave India and settle down there K - The superstition. It's not about being superstitious. As a producer, the first film I made was Aap Ke Deewane. Then I made Kaamchor and the third film was Jaag Utha Insaan and the fourth film was Bhagwaan Dada as a producer. Once a fan wrote to me that I should only start my films with the alphabet 'K' because all my films as an actor have done well. Like Khatta Meetha, Khubsoorat, Khel Khel Mein and Kaamchor and Khandaan. Then I made a film called Khudgarz and the same fan wrote to me saying that the film worked because I titled it with 'K'. That's how this fan mail stayed into my head for a long time, even till today. Director v/s Director Rakesh Roshan Kites was first planned to be directed by me. I happened to be in some of the award functions and four names popped up every time I saw the best film categories - Munnabhai, Rang De Basanti, Krissh and Gangster. But somehow I was a little curious to know why a film like Gangster would fit into such nominations. So I saw the film and loved it. I was completely blown by Anurag Basu's direction. He deserves a good break. I called him and asked him, "I want Hrithik to work with you. Have you got any good story?" Anurag said, "No Rakeshji. I make small films with small budgets. With Hrithik, I'll need a bigger canvas." Seeing his honesty, I told him, "I have a story, and if it touches you, and you think that you will do full justice to the film, then I want you to direct it." Anurag wasn't sure if I was willing to give him Kites to direct. After a month, Anurag came back with his own thoughts and a few changes and I was convinced that he will be the man to direct Kites. Canvas There are two things. When I was making Kaho Naa Pyaar Hai, I could've shot the same thing in Madh Island too. But I didn't. The content would've been the same but what about the canvas? Canvas is not that I'm putting thousand dancers instead of ten dancers. That's throwing away money. If it's a desert, it has to be different. We have seen the Thar desert, but what if we get the desert from Mexico. That stays in your mind. The ambience has a local flavour. Barbara Mori We were looking out for a lot of girls who could speak Spanish. We were sure that we didn't want any Indian actress because it would look fake. So I went to Los Angeles and met two to three actresses out there. But then I thought, I wouldn't be comfortable to make Kites with such big names too. A friend of mine called me on my return to Mumbai and urged me to watch a Spanish film. There was Barbara Mori in the film. In the very first instinct, I liked her. She had to be my heroine. I showed it to Anurag and he too approved of her. Even Hrithik said, "This is the girl for Kites." I flew from Mumbai to Los Angeles with Anurag Basu and she flew down from Mexico to Los Angeles. We narrated the script to her. She liked it initially. What we wanted was right in front of us. She didn't know English at all and that's what we wanted. An hour's narration took me four hours to narrate to Barbara Mori. She was a keen listener and had tears in her eyes in-between the narration. Then she would laugh. Barbara immediately said 'Yes' to Kites. Bankable Our Indian Film Industry has become stagnant. We don't want to grow I was never sure how Koi Mil Gaya, Krrish, or Kaho Naa Pyaar Hai would fare. But I was very sure that people will see all these films and quote, "Rakesh Roshan has made a good film." With Kites, I expect the same, and that is the best compliment I get every time I make a good film. Success is not in our hands. Success is in our audiences hands. We have put our best foot forward with Kites and today I can vouch for this that no Indian film has been made on this standard. Kangna Ranaut Rakesh Roshan I am thankful to Kangna Ranaut for accepting the role in Kites. She is a very honest girl, a thorough professional and would come up to me and say, "Rakeshji, Anurag ko bulao. Kya karna hain, kaise karna hain." (Rakesh, please call Anurag and tell me what am I to do and how) Kangna's English accent isn't good. So we kept a tutor for her as her role is of a girl born and brought up in the United States of America. Kangna religiously learned how to speak English with an American accent. Bollywood - A small pond Our Indian Film Industry has become stagnant. We don't want to grow. We want to use the same comedy formula in all our films, the same thriller angle in all our films. Yes, there are some good films coming out since a few years like Dev D, Love Sex Aur Dhoka, etc which are a good start. We are trying to change lanes and that's very promising. But maybe we are not getting the success we want. Not to forget, we are changing the audiences mind too. If we give them all bikini girls, those days are gone.

Nargise Bagheri strips down to stop cruelty against horses in new PETA ad

Nargise Bagheri The Garam Masala and Kushti actress warns that horses and city traffic are a dangerous mix. Nargise Bagheri stripped down Lady Godiva-style for a leading role in a stunning new ad for People for the Ethical Treatment of Animals (PETA) India, hoping to draw attention to the plight of horses who are used to pull carts that bear heavy loads or people seeking "joyrides". In the ad, Bagheri - covered only by her long hair - poses on a dark "horse" next to the words "Don't Get Taken for a Ride, Horse-Drawn Carts Are Cruel". By appearing in the ad, Bagheri seeks to warn potential tonga and victoria passengers that these joyrides are joyless for the horses and potentially dangerous for both riders and horses. "Horse carts are cruel and outdated and should be relegated to the history books", says Bagheri. "In the city, the mix of horses and traffic can make for a lethal combination for horses and passengers." Well, we have heard of the Black Beauty, but this is taking beauty to a new height.

Gulzar gets unique gift from Mani Ratnam, Raavan gets new song in return

Gulzar Mani Ratnam's Raavan has just been given a new song, thanks to that poet par excellence Gulzar who saw the film and suggested the embellishment. The director, always open to fresh ideas from his team, readily agreed. Composer Rahman was informed and that's how Raavan got a new song. Gulzar Saab, who just back from Goa after participating in the stage rendition of four of his plays, says the song was almost a gift he owed Mani Ratnam for gifting him something that he, Gulzar, had never received in his entire 47-year old career as a lyricist. Mani sent the poet-lyricist a note after the release of the Raavan music congratulating Gulzar Saab for the songs. Says Gulzar Saab, "In my entire career I've never received such a heartwarming endorsement of my work. I received a note from Mani Ratnam congratulating me and saying he's very proud of the music. And look at the humility of this genius. No filmmaker has ever sent me a note like this. Mani is the only one. And this one gesture has enhanced my respect for him even more." Not only this gesture, Gulzar Saab also received an invitation from Mani to see the film at a special screening for which the poet flew down to Chennai recently. It was there that the new song suddenly happened. Recounts Gulzar Saab, "After editing Raavan, Mani wanted me to watch the film. No filmmaker invites even the technical crew for a preview, let alone the lyricist. I flew down to Chennai to watch the film. I'd never do something like this for anyone else. This is how strongly I feel about this man's humility and greatness." As the end-credits rolled and Rahman's music began, Mani Ratnam and Gulzar Saab thought there ought to be a song at the end. That's how Gulzar Saab wrote an additional number for Raavan... 'Ab Iss Shareer Ke Sirey Khol Dey/Aur Goongi Aatma Ko Bol Dey'. Says Gulzar Saab, "Both Mani and I felt the music that Rahman had composed for the end titles was too beautiful to go wordless. We decided to give words to Rahman's creation." Rahman was then given the task of turning the music piece into a song. Interestingly neither Mani Ratnam nor A. R. Rahman fully understands Gulzar's Urdu poetry. Defends Gulzar Saab, "But they are never short of questions. Never does a word go in until Mani is fully convinced of its relevance. He's never hesitant about asking. I would be appalled if my words were accepted blindly by a director. Even if his Urdu is weak, Mani has a terrific sense of poetry and images."

Exploring the 10 year journey of Hrithik Roshan [Part IV]

Hrithik Roshan In this special four part feature, Joginder Tuteja would be taking readers through the 10 years journey of Hrithik Roshan which has been nothing but a roller coaster ride. Seeing early success, Hrithik saw himself starting at the bottom of the barrel before a great resurgence brought a turnaround in fortunes. (Concluding) Part IV of this feature takes readers through the risky route that Hrithik has (successfully) undertaken during last three years and is expected to follow in the years ahead That scary feel Jodhaa Akbar had more wrongs going for it than rights throughout its making. An exhausting schedule took it's toll on the actors, period drama meant that research was always a challenge (something which also saw controversies building up around the release), there were tell tale marks of tiredness setting in as the film struggled to come close to the finishing mark, industry detractors too had their daggers out as attacking a period drama is always a convenient exercise, the music (by A.R. Rahman) too didn't find much appreciation before the release and there were talks that even the producers (UTV Motion Pictures) were worried about their product's eventual prospects. Their worries weren't ill placed though. On release, the morning shows opened to a lukewarm response. This was the age of multiplexes and it was the first weekend that announced a film's success or failure. In case of Jodhaa Akbar, it seemed that the film was headed more towards being a box office disappointment since despite pick up in collections, there weren't any huge roars from audience that would have brought the film into a comfort zone. And then a miracle happened! Hrithik Roshan The film hung on to his life and started showing good sustenance even on week days. By the time second weekend came calling, the writing was clear on the wall - 'The hit run of Hrithik Roshan was there to stay'. Despite it's near four hour length (with no trimming coming in despite criticism), Jodhaa Akbar found good money coming its way. Of course no major releases for weeks at stretch meant that the film had a clear run but still the fact remained that this Ashutosh Gowariker film added on to Hrithik's successes. It may not have come anywhere close to the benchmark created by Dhoom 2 but ensured nevertheless that audience would have their hearts beating for the man when his next film comes calling. A landmark year ahead Though it wasn't designed this way (Kites could have released in 2009 itself), the fact remains that yet again, it was time for a two year break for Hrithik as far as his big screen appearance was concerned. Are the audience complaining? Well yes, they were till last year but not anymore as the promos have finally hit the screens, hence ensuring that the film is pretty much for the keeps. For them as well as industry in general, the film is a huge bet by itself since Bollywood is going through its lowest phase ever, at least in the current year. Roshan family, with an outsider Anurag Basu, had a job cut down for them and this time around, nothing less than extraordinary would be acceptable by anyone. To the film's credit, buzz is quite good already and though there is still a month to go for the release, there is huge amount of anticipation build up that has taken place. Hrithik Roshan However, the man amidst all the action, Hrithik Roshan, can well be expected to be the most worried (or shall we say anxious?) of all. For audience, Kites is just another film from which they are expecting three hours of non-stop entertainment. For industry, Kites is just one of those 5 odd films this year which come with the potential of doing a business of 100 crores plus. However, for Hrithik it is a big risk which could result in terrific gains or terrible losses. For him, this is one film where he has given two years of his life and faced some in-house issues at work as well as home front. He knows that he cannot disappoint the audience or the industry but the biggest of it all; he can't afford to disappoint himself. Yes, there is a Guzaarish coming before close of year as well but when it comes to Kites, which is a home production where a sum of dozens of crores has been invested, nothing, and really nothing, can afford to go wrong. Will he get it right? Well, if he is indeed following the Aamir Khan model of working, something which has taken the shape of a magic potion that always works, he certainly will! Priti Shahani to join Reliance Big Pictures

Priti Shahani is joining Reliance Big Pictures as Chief Strategy & Marketing Officer. She will be a key member involved in planning the overall strategy of the company along with handling the worldwide marketing campaigns of all films Reliance Big Pictures releases. She will start in her role in mid-June. Priti recently resigned from Studio 18/The Indian Film Company, where she was Sr Vice President Marketing, Distribution & Syndication. During her tenure here, she oversaw the aggressive marketing and distribution campaigns for blockbuster films such as WELCOME, SINGH IS KINNG and GHAJINI and also unlocked hidden revenue for films by introducing the Satellite Rights syndication model with JAB WE MET [the first Hindi film to be syndicated across channels], which has now become the norm within the industry.
